Why this must be read: It's beautiful and bleak and shows just how bad Aeryn would be with a baby. This Aeryn is disconnected from whatever maternal feelings she may be experiencing, yet she's determined that she'd going to do everything herself and that she doesn't need any help.
And then John shows up.
The writing in this is lyrical and rich with description, without being purple or overly florid. It starts out like this:
"If you hold yourself still, if you capture the light and span of that gray place against your retina, it has a bleak beauty. A fragile beauty, despite its vastness, because its delicate features are all but invisible, and if you breathe too soon it collapses, is only space."
And gets only more lovely from there.
